+ * rofi_scorer_fuzzy_evaluate implements a global sequence alignment algorithm to find the maximum accumulated score by
+ * aligning `pattern` to `str`. It applies when `pattern` is a subsequence of `str`.
+ *
+ * Scoring criteria
+ * - Prefer matches at the start of a word, or the start of subwords in CamelCase/camelCase/camel123 words. See WORD_START_SCORE/CAMEL_SCORE.
+ * - Non-word characters matter. See NON_WORD_SCORE.
+ * - The first characters of words of `pattern` receive bonus because they usually have more significance than the rest.
+ * See PATTERN_START_MULTIPLIER/PATTERN_NON_START_MULTIPLIER.
+ * - Superfluous characters in `str` will reduce the score (gap penalty). See GAP_SCORE.
+ * - Prefer early occurrence of the first character. See LEADING_GAP_SCORE/GAP_SCORE.
+ *
+ * The recurrence of the dynamic programming:
+ * dp[i][j]: maximum accumulated score by aligning pattern[0..i] to str[0..j]
+ * dp[0][j] = leading_gap_penalty(0, j) + score[j]
+ * dp[i][j] = max(dp[i-1][j-1] + CONSECUTIVE_SCORE, max(dp[i-1][k] + gap_penalty(k+1, j) + score[j] : k < j))
+ *
+ * The first dimension can be suppressed since we do not need a matching scheme, which reduces the space complexity from
+ * O(N*M) to O(M)
